Output 24dae1752f0693196647906bbc890c9a91414115eb74d1eaf02f23f035a7d361:0

value
3930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645119108ffc3bbb61a2201fdd29b871876073eb OP_EQUAL
address
3AqSeWSADm9XJRWDuNmcrL5A1iZTVCEeya
transaction
24dae1752f0693196647906bbc890c9a91414115eb74d1eaf02f23f035a7d361
spent
true